Commercial Description:
This extra strong spicy Belgian pumpkin ale is truly a beer from the farm. It is unfiltered with a beautiful Burnt orange color. Ichabod’s nose is filled with flavors of the harvest including clove, allspice, cinnamon, and nutmeg. The palette is sweet with hints of roasted pumpkin, and caramel. There is a warming finish that is both fruity and aromatic. Over 6 pounds of pumpkin per barrel were added right to the mash. Drink enough and you’ll lose your head too!
